Alexey Arkhipov is a researcher at the forefront of integrating artificial intelligence into the oil and gas industry, with a particular focus on drilling optimization and digitalization. His work addresses the critical challenge of improving efficiency and safety in drilling operations by leveraging neural networks and machine learning. His most-cited paper, "Drilling Problems Forecast System Based on Neural Network" (2020, 11 citations), exemplifies his contribution to predictive modeling, offering a system that anticipates drilling complications to reduce downtime and operational risks.
